			<description><![CDATA[<p> Hello eya,</p><p>If the file-browser of converter shows the file, it should be found by other file-browsers, too...</p><p>What version of QElectroTech do you use?</p><p>Version 0.9 is a bit outdated in the meantime ... I recommend 0.100-dev</p><p>And it is very recommendet to use <strong>dxf2elmt</strong> instead of something else!</p><p>In current versions of QET there is a menu-entry in Element-editor to import a dxf with <strong>dxf2elmt</strong>.<br />Then you don&#039;t have to handle converted files, but can work with QET alone.</p><p>Vadoola, the current author of <strong>dxf2elmt</strong>, released new sources today.<br />I guess you run win? In the attachment you find the compiled binary. </p>]]></description>
